Not-for-Profit and Church Management Graduate Certificate
The Not-for-Profit and Church Management Graduate Certificate is designed to increase the proficiency of not-for-profit and church administrators/professionals, leading to more effective management in finance and human resources, and to enable them to better accomplish their mission and ministry.
This innovative program is designed to benefit:
• Individuals already working in the not-for-profit sector.
• Individuals who wish to switch careers.
• Successful business professionals who are seeking a way to “make a difference” in today’s world.
Real-World Impact
Our Not-for-Profit and Church Management Graduate Certificate students have the passion to make a difference in the world. We've developed a curriculum that responds to their needs.
• Real-World Application: After learning about the not-for-profit’s organizational purpose, governance and funding structures, students will participate in a service learning project that will transform theories into action.
•
Financial Management: Financial accountability and internal controls are essential in transforming an organization’s purpose into reality. Courses examine financial management tools for decision making such as operational forecasts, budgets and incremental analysis.
•
Recruiting and Fund Development: Recruiting and motivation of volunteers is an essential skill that our program develops. In addition, students will learn how to create and communicate current and long-range strategic plans and grant applications.
